Challenges and Concerns
While First Advantage Debt Relief has a reputation for excellence, there are potential challenges and concerns to consider:
• **Fees and Costs**: Debt settlement companies like First Advantage Relief charge fees for their services, which can range from 15% to 25% of the settled debt amount. Clients must carefully review and understand these fees before committing to a plan.
• **Credit Score Impact**: Debt settlement can temporarily negatively affect credit scores, as creditors may report settled debt as "settled" or "paid as agreed." However, First Advantage Debt Relief works to minimize this impact and help clients rebuild their credit over time.
• **Tax Consequences**: Settled debt may be considered taxable income, and clients may be required to report the amount as income on their tax return. First Advantage Debt Relief advises clients on tax implications and provides guidance on how to navigate these complexities.
